Also for using leftover turkey .. HOT BROWNS (receipe from the Brown Hotel in Louisville, KY)

open face turkey sandwich

toast
layer of turkey (and/or ham)
layer of turkey gravy
layer of cheese sause
layer of bacon (partially cooked)

grill until bacon is crisp ..serve hot

YUM YUM .. would almost rather have Hot Browns than the Turkey-Day dinner
Our tradition is to have Hot Browns for dinner on Black Friday! FYI, your toast should be cheap ole white bread, cheese sauce should be white and preferably homemade (no cheddar sauces, PLEASE) and stick that baby under the broiler until bubbly and browned.
